Pettibone Extendo 1246X telehandler boasts 12,000-lb. lift capacity
Pettibone’s new Extendo 1246X Telehandler features 12,000-pound lifting capacity for contractors and rental users working in demanding construction jobsite conditions. Volvo CE sales up 10% in 2Q on improvement in North America, Europe
Volvo Construction Equipment saw sales increase by 10 percent year over year in the second quarter.
